Snowing me, snowing you … there is something we CAN do!

IAM RoadSmart brings you expert advice on driving in snow from its head of driving and riding advice Richard Gladman.

Best advice is to avoid travelling in extreme weather. If no one is moving, you just add to the problem – so listen to travel advice.

McLaren Special Operations deliver 10 unique 570S Coupes

TEN unique McLaren sportscars that emulate the look and feel of a McLaren 570S GT4 race car but are fully road-legal have been delivered to their new owners at a special McLaren customer event near Las Vegas, USA.

Land Rover Defender’s last hurrah? The V8 70th Edition

Land Rover have announced a limited-edition high-performance version of the iconic Defender, with up to 150 V8-powered examples re-engineered to celebrate the Land Rover marque’s 70th anniversary in 2018.
